Surfers Paradise has reclaimed the title of the number one location for unit sales, with the Gold Coast boasting half of Queensland’s top 10 performing suburbs, according to the latest property data.
Prop tech firm InfoTrack has released its latest Property Market Update, listing suburbs with the highest volume of sales from 1 April to 30 June this year.
InfoTrack’s Head of Property Australia, Lee Bailie, said Surfers Paradise had clawed its way back to first position in the residential unit market.
“After dominating quarter on quarter, Surfers Paradise fell to second place for the previous two quarters, behind Southport and Brisbane City – but no longer,” Mr Bailie said.
“Interestingly, we saw the reemergence of Burleigh Heads, which made the list for the first time since Q1 2023, in at eighth spot.
“Other local top performing suburbs included Southport (in fourth position), Hope Island (in at number six), and Broadbeach (sliding in at number 10). After coming in 10th position in Q1, Mermaid Beach dropped off the top 10 for Q2.
“Demand for inner-city living in Brisbane strongly influenced residential unit sales, with Newstead appearing back in the top 10 for the first time since Q2 2024,” he said.
“The inclusion of Newstead, alongside sustained interest in neighbouring suburbs Fortitude Valley and Brisbane City, reflects strong demand from buyers seeking an inner-city apartment lifestyle.”
Mr Bailie said the Gold Coast also performed strongly in the housing market.
“While the Ipswich suburb of Springfield Lakes took the crown for the greatest number of house sales last quarter, the fringe Gold Coast suburbs of Ormeau and Pimpama continued to attract buyers,” he said.
“Situated in the northern Gold Coast region, Ormeau, has risen from number six in Q1 to third position in Q2. Its strategic location between Brisbane and the Gold Coast makes it an attractive choice for families, professionals, and investors.”
Townsville’s Kirwan is the only suburb on either list located outside Southeast Queensland.
InfoTrack’s data found houses have continued to dominate in Queensland, taking 60.96 per cent (%) of the market last quarter. This represents a steady increase of 0.5% quarter-on-quarter.

Top 10 Queensland Suburbs – InfoTrack Property Market Update Q2 2025
Units | |
1 | Surfers Paradise |
2 | Newstead |
3 | Brisbane City |
4 | Southport |
5 | Fortitude Valley |
6 | Hope Island |
7 | South Brisbane |
8 | Burleigh Heads |
9 | Maroochydore |
10 | Broadbeach |
Houses | |
1 | Springfield Lakes |
2 | Caboolture |
3 | Ormeau |
4 | Redbank Plains |
5 | Morayfield |
6 | Burpengary |
7 | Narangba |
8 | Kirwan |
9 | Pimpama |
10 | Yarabilba |
